The Geofencing Market comprises location-based technology solutions that create virtual geographic boundaries around real-world areas using GPS, RFID, Wi-Fi, cellular data, or IP address-based positioning systems. Geofencing enables automated actions, alerts, and data collection when a device, user, or asset enters, exits, or moves within a defined digital perimeter. This technology is widely used across industries such as retail, transportation and logistics, automotive, healthcare, advertising, smart cities, security, and workforce management to enhance operational efficiency, customer engagement, safety, and real-time monitoring capabilities.

The market includes software platforms, mobile applications, cloud-based geolocation services, location intelligence tools, and integration APIs that enable businesses to deploy and manage geofencing capabilities. It also encompasses hardware components such as GPS-enabled devices, IoT sensors, beacons, telematics systems, and connected infrastructure that support precise location tracking. Manufacturers and service providers focus on improving location accuracy, real-time responsiveness, scalability, data security, and integration with enterprise systems such as customer relationship management (CRM), fleet management, and marketing automation platforms.

logoRestraints

  • Privacy Concerns and Regulatory Compliance Challenges

One of the primary restraints affecting the Geofencing Market is the growing concern regarding user privacy and data protection. Geofencing solutions rely heavily on collecting and processing location data, which can raise concerns among consumers regarding how their personal information is stored, shared, and utilized. Increasing public awareness of data privacy issues has led many users to restrict location-sharing permissions, potentially limiting the effectiveness of geofencing applications and reducing the available audience for location-based campaigns.

Additionally, organizations deploying geofencing technologies must comply with evolving data protection regulations and privacy laws across different jurisdictions. Regulatory frameworks often impose strict requirements regarding user consent, data collection, storage practices, and information security. Ensuring compliance with these regulations can increase implementation costs and operational complexity for businesses. Failure to adhere to legal requirements may result in financial penalties, reputational damage, and reduced consumer trust.

logoChallenges

  • Location Accuracy Limitations and Technology Integration Issues

A major challenge facing the Geofencing Market is ensuring accurate and reliable location tracking across diverse environments. Factors such as signal interference, GPS inaccuracies, indoor positioning limitations, and network connectivity issues can affect the precision of geofencing systems. Inaccurate location data may lead to ineffective notifications, operational inefficiencies, and reduced user satisfaction. Maintaining consistent performance across urban, rural, indoor, and outdoor environments remains a critical challenge for solution providers.

Another significant challenge involves integrating geofencing technologies with existing enterprise systems and digital infrastructure. Organizations often operate multiple software platforms, databases, and operational technologies that must work seamlessly with geofencing applications. Achieving interoperability while maintaining data security, system performance, and scalability can be complex and resource-intensive. As businesses continue to expand their digital ecosystems, overcoming integration challenges will be essential for maximizing the value and effectiveness of geofencing solutions.
